  • Patent number: 7205036
    Abstract: An adhesive tape product comprises a length of adhesive tape mounted on a core with a reduced tendency to telescope. A layer of compressible foam is provided between the core and the body of tape wound on the core. Alternatively, the core is fabricated to have a slight bulge in its center giving the core a barrel shape thereby reducing the tendency for the body of tape wound upon the core to telescope.

  • Patent number: 7204890
    Abstract: Many prior art processes for cleaning predominantly organic hard surfaces have been found to be considerably less effective in removing very fine particles on such surfaces than are the best cleaners for metallic surfaces. However, it has been found, and forms the basis of this invention, that fine particles can be removed effectively from organic surfaces by an indirect process of first forming a thin solid coating over the surface and then removing the solid coating, into which the fine particles that formerly contaminated the surface to be cleaned have presumably become incorporated. Substantially hydrolyzed poly(vinyl acetate) has been found particularly useful for forming the thin solid coating when this coating is to be removed by treatment with an acidic aqueous solution; acrylate polymers are preferred if the solid coating is to be removed by an alkaline aqueous solution.
